4.63 out of 5 stars

REDEFINES SPORT IN SUV

WTD, 05/20/2009
2005 Jeep Grand Cherokee Laredo 4WD 4dr SUV (3.7L 6cyl 5A)
0 of 0 people found this review helpful

With over 4 years and nearly 60,000 miles I have to say this has been the best SUV ever ! I've been in all driving conditions ( 10in. of snow, down pours, gravel, dirt,uphill, towing and uneven pavement ) with zero problems. JEEP handled everything with ease. Equipped with 3.7L engine and 4WD has plenty of power for road use. Gas mileage was much better at over 22 hwy and 18 city than the Honda Pilot I got rid of.

4.63 out of 5 stars

Wish I bought 2

Don B, 09/10/2010
2005 Jeep Grand Cherokee Laredo 4WD 4dr SUV (3.7L 6cyl 5A)
0 of 0 people found this review helpful

Great vehicle. I bought it for winter all wheel drive and towing motorcycles. It has done everything well. Comfortable and quiet for travel. Only mechanical issue is a stripped cog on the electric seat adjustment (it gets used a lot). Just reached 60,000 after five years. Only drawbacks, besides the seat, are poor fuel economy in town and towing, and the relatively extensive routine maintenance. On balance, compared to other cars and trucks I've owned, it has been a good value. My wife likes it, so it would be nice to have two (the seat would last longer).
